Course Overview:

This advanced medical course is designed for healthcare professionals specializing in prenatal care and fetal abdominal wall defects. The course centers around crucial skills in nuchal translucency assessment at 13 weeks and detailed fetal anatomical surveys at 21 weeks. Using real-life case studies, such as the one involving herniation of fetal abdominal contents and its progression, participants will gain in-depth knowledge and practical skills.
